Name story

Jadan is a modern variant of Jadon, a name with ancient biblical roots. In the Hebrew scriptures, Jadon (ידון) appears in the Book of Nehemiah as one of the builders who helped repair the walls of Jerusalem — a quiet, industrious figure associated with community and restoration. The name is thought to mean "He will judge" or "thankful," derived from the Hebrew root yadah, connected to gratitude and acknowledgment.

This biblical origin gives the name a foundation far older than its contemporary popularity might suggest. The name entered mainstream American culture largely through the phonetic creativity of the 1990s and 2000s, when Jaden, Jadon, Jayden, and their variants became enormously popular, buoyed in part by celebrity usage — most notably Will Smith naming his son Jaden in 1998. The wave of -aden and -ayden names reshaped American naming culture for a generation.

Jadan, with its distinctive "a" in the second syllable, sits slightly apart from the mainstream spellings, giving it a more individualized feel while remaining phonetically familiar. What makes Jadan interesting as a name is how it bridges worlds: ancient enough to carry biblical gravitas, modern enough to feel fresh, and phonetically comfortable across multiple linguistic communities. It has been adopted across African American, Caribbean, and multicultural families in particular, acquiring a kind of contemporary urban identity that coexists with its scriptural past. As naming trends cycle, the core sound remains appealing — strong, open, and unambiguous.
